About Hee Chan Song
Hee Chan Song is a scholar working on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ment, Catalysis and Materials Chemistry, having authored 12 papers that have together received 346 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Electrocatalysts for Energy Conversion (8 papers), Catalytic Processes in Materials Science (8 papers) and Catalysis and Oxidation Reactions (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Catalysis (89 citations),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ment (186 citations) and Materials Chemistry (277 citations). Hee Chan Song has collaborated with scholars based in South Korea, Canada and United States. Frequent co-authors include Jeong Young Park, Song Yi Moon, Daeho Kim, Beomgyun Jeong, Ievgen I. Nedrygailov, Changhwan Lee, Jeong Jin Kim, Won Hui Doh, Si Woo Lee and Ryong Ryoo. Their work appears in journals such as ACS Nano, Applied Physics Letters and Applied Catalysis B: Environmental.
